I am using libva to decode JPEG. I want to then use decoded surface as a gl
texture. This works fine if I use copySurfaceGLX(). However it seems that
the copy surface is slow (450MB/s) on Intel i7 ivy bridge 4770. Possibly
because it is waiting for sync ... Not sure. I am assuming that it is
possible to use the decoded result directly by associating it with a
texture target. To this end I tried to implement with EGL. However va_egl.h
no longer contains any of the surface management functions that it used to.
Without transitioning to wayland, I am uncertain what to do.
Can someone please point me in the right direction.
